The Puyallup Tribe’s donation of $200,000 to Northwest Harvest will help keep food on the table for countless struggling families. Tribal officials presented the check during King 5's Home Team Harvest event at the Tacoma Mall on Dec. 7. “It’s such a great feeling to be able to take care of those in need,” said Councilmember David Bean. “As Indian people, we’re taught to take care of our land and community, and it’s wonderful to be in the position to be able to make contributions to help others.”
Northwest Harvest is Washington’s only non-profit hunger relief agency that operates statewide, providing nutritious food to hungry people throughout the state. The organization provides more than 1.7 million meals each month, and 26 million pounds per year to its network of emergency food providers.
